“It is glorious to see such courage in one so young!” So declared Confederate General Robert E. Lee on December 13, 1862, during the battle of Fredericksburg as he watched Major John Pelham fight at least five Union batteries with just one lone gun. The dashing and handsome 24-year-old Alabama officer earned the compliments and admiration of his men, the war gods of Virginia (Lee, Jackson, and Stuart), and Southern society—all while helping transform the concept of horse artillery on Civil War battlefields across Virginia and Maryland.

The Newgate Prison was a prison in London, at the corner of Newgate Street and Old Bailey, just inside the city of London. It was originally located at the site of Newgate, a gate in the Roman London Wall. The gate/prison was rebuilt in the 12th century and demolished in 1904. The prison was extended and rebuilt many times, and remained in use for over 700 years, from 1188 to 1902.
